MUICP definition

MUICP. (eurozone) for a Contract expressed in euro (as a general rule);
MUICP published for the first time by the Publications Office of the European Union in the Eurostat monthly 'Data in Focus' publication at xxxx://xxx.xx.xxxxxx.xx/eurostat/. Revision shall be calculated in accordance with the following formula: Ir Pr = Po (0,2+0,8 — ) Io where: Pr = revised price; Po = price in the original tender; Io = index for the month [in which the validity of the tender expires] [corresponding to the final date for submission of tenders]; Ir = index for the month [corresponding to the date of receipt of the letter requesting a revision of prices] [in which the revised prices take effect]].

  • HICPs form the basis of the Monetary Union Index of Consumer Prices (MUICP) used by, among others, the European Central Bank for the monitoring of inflation in the Economic and Monetary Union.
